Kwalee is one of the world’s leading multiplatform game publishers, with well over 600 million downloads worldwide for mobile hits such as Draw It, Teacher Simulator, Let’s Be Cops 3D and Makeover Studio 3D. Alongside this, we also have a growing PC and console team of incredible pedigree that is on the hunt for great new titles to join TENS! and Eternal Hope.

With a team of talented people collaborating daily between our studios in Leamington Spa, Bangalore and Beijing, or on a remote basis from Turkey, Brazil, the Philippines and many more, we have a truly global team making games for a global audience. And it’s paying off: Kwalee games have been downloaded in every country on earth! If you think you’re a good fit for one of our remote vacancies, we want to hear from you wherever you are based.

Founded in 2011 by David Darling CBE, a key architect of the UK games industry who previously co-founded and led Codemasters for many years, our team also includes legends such as Andrew Graham (creator of Micro Machines series) and Jason Falcus (programmer of classics including NBA Jam) alongside a growing and diverse team of global gaming experts. As Casual Games Monetisation Game Designer you have experience creating key monetisation systems within F2P games. You’ll work closely with every department to create monetisation opportunities for our games.

What you will really be doing

  • Working as part of the design team, designing monetisation strategies for existing and upcoming games with a focus on In-app purchases.
  • Working with functionality designers to create compelling purchasing opportunities.
  • Evolving and adapting game designs based on play testing, feedback and live metrics.
  • Working with the analytics department, driving long term player engagement by understanding mobile players needs and motivations.
  • Working with the different departments to manage content and pricing for in-game purchases
  • Analysing of emerging F2P monetisation trends

Skills and requirements

  • A minimum of 3 years experience in a monetisation design role with at least one published game.
  • Experience working with F2P mobile games.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Expert knowledge of mobile free-to-play game monetisation.
  • Ability to work creatively in a demanding team environment.
  • Absolute passion for playing and making video games, especially mobile games.
  • Strong creative ideas and imagination, able to entertain players with challenges, humour, surprises and fun.
  • Positive attitude, self driven and able to work alone or as part of a team.

Desirable

  • Unity experience.
  • Background in economics, marketing, data science or similar.
  • Creative writing skills.
  • Coding / prototyping skills.
  • Experience of mobile game live ops, A/B testing and telemetry.
  • Knowledge of mobile game market, trends, competition, platforms and app stores.
  • Desire to learn about ad-based monetisation and improve our efforts in hypercasual as well.
